Brandywine Community Schools in Niles, Michigan is looking for a Varsity Softball Head Coach. The ideal candidate will be a motivator and tactician who can elevate the team and lead student-athletes on the field with a focus on skill development and personal growth.
The coach will work closely with other coaches, ensure program alignment, and engage positively with the school community. Relevant experience in coaching and strong communication skills are essential for this role.

The Varsity Head Coach is responsible for overseeing all aspects of the varsity athletic program for their assigned sport. This includes leading student-athletes in skill development, competition, and personal growth while upholding the values and expectations of the athletic department and school district.
